Market Overview
The deep learning market represents a specialized segment of artificial intelligence that employs multi-layered neural networks to identify patterns and make predictions from complex datasets. It spans three primary components: hardware infrastructure including GPUs, TPUs, and AI accelerators; software platforms and development frameworks; and professional services for deployment and integration. Organizations across multiple industries have adopted deep learning to automate decision-making processes and derive insights from unstructured data sources such as images, text, and audio.
- •Market valued at approximately $125.4 billion as of 2025
- •Projected to grow at 31.7% compound annual growth rate over the forecast period
- •Some industry projections indicate potential to reach approximately $296 billion by 2031
Growth Drivers
The exponential growth in data generation across digital platforms has created unprecedented demand for automated analysis capabilities that deep learning provides. Advances in semiconductor technology and cloud computing infrastructure have significantly reduced the computational costs and time required to train sophisticated neural network models. Furthermore, demonstrated success in high-impact applications such as medical imaging, fraud detection, and autonomous navigation has validated deep learning's business value and spurred continued investment.
- •Rising volume of structured and unstructured data requiring advanced pattern recognition
- •Continuous improvements in GPU architecture, AI accelerators, and cloud computing resources
- •Growing enterprise demand for automation and intelligent decision-support systems
Segmentation and Regional Analysis
The market is commonly segmented by offering type into hardware, software, and services categories, with hardware maintaining a substantial share due to the intensive computational requirements of neural network training operations. End-user industries span healthcare, automotive, retail, finance, manufacturing, and media, each leveraging deep learning for distinct use cases such as diagnostic imaging, autonomous driving, personalized recommendations, and predictive maintenance. Geographically, North America currently holds the largest market share supported by robust technology infrastructure and major AI research institutions, while Asia-Pacific emerges as the fastest-growing region fueled by manufacturing automation and national AI development initiatives.
- •Hardware segment includes GPUs, specialized AI accelerators, and high-bandwidth memory systems optimized for parallel processing
- •Healthcare, automotive, and retail represent the most prominent application verticals
- •North America leads in market share, with Asia-Pacific demonstrating the strongest growth momentum
Trends and Outlook
What are the recent trends and outlook?
The market is experiencing a shift toward more efficient model architectures and edge deployment capabilities, enabling deep learning applications to operate closer to data sources with reduced latency. Autonomous systems and robotics represent particularly dynamic application segments, with projections indicating growth rates exceeding broader market averages as the underlying technologies mature. Long-term market trajectories suggest sustained expansion as industries increasingly integrate deep learning into core operational workflows and novel use cases emerge in areas such as scientific research, climate modeling, and personalized medicine.
- •Edge AI deployment and model compression techniques enabling deep learning on mobile and IoT devices
- •Autonomous systems and robotics segment projected to grow at 37.2% CAGR, outpacing overall market growth
- •Continued expansion anticipated as deep learning becomes embedded across industrial and consumer applications
